新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版

新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版 pdf epub mobi txt 電子書 下載 2025

圖書標籤:
  • PHP7
  • MySQL
  • AJAX
  • 網頁設計
  • PHP開發
  • Web開發
  • 實例教程
  • 第五版
  • 編程入門
  • 服務器端編程
想要找書就要到 小特書站
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

  用豐富、實務的範例, 纍積伺服網頁應用的開發經驗

  PHP 是目前最通用的伺服端網頁技術,在曆經開發人員十年的努力,終於推齣最新版本 PHP7。

  本書定位上是一本入門 PHP7 網頁程式設計的學習教材,使用 XAMPP 整閤安裝套件來安裝 PHP+MySQL 執行與測試環境,結閤 MySQL 資料庫和 AJAX 技術,可輕易打造各種動態網頁效果,帶領您進入最熱門的伺服端網頁程式應用的殿堂。

  本書設計有豐富的案例,就算沒有網頁程式的基礎也可順利入門,另外本書最後提供二個完整的專案實例,第一個是簡化版 CMS 內容管理係統,第二個是一套廉價航空公司的訂票係統,纍積實務網站開發的經驗。

本書特色

  ● 完整 PHP 背景技術和語法說明:你就算沒有學過任何網頁技術,也一樣可以學習PHP程式設計,輕鬆配閤MySQL資料庫建立網頁資料庫。

  ● 最簡單的PHP開發環境建立:直接使用整閤安裝套件XAMPP一次就同時安裝和設定Apache、PHP和MySQL,快速建立PHP開發環境。

  ● 使用中文版PHP程式碼編輯器:本書提供簡單好用的中文版PHP程式碼編輯器,和功能錶程式碼片段,可以讓你輕鬆建立和測試執行PHP程式。

  ● MySQL 擴充程式 ext/mysqli 與 PDO:本書使用ext/mysqli擴充程式和PDO建立網頁資料庫,支援物件導嚮介麵的資料庫存取和使用Prepared Statement執行SQL指令。

  ● 動態行動裝置頁麵:使用 jQuery Mobile 和 PHP 建立行動裝置瀏覽的 Mobile 網頁。
《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》 內容概述 本書旨在為讀者提供一套全麵、深入且與時俱進的Web開發技術棧學習指南,重點聚焦於當前業界主流的PHP 7.x版本、MySQL數據庫操作以及AJAX異步數據交互技術的實戰應用。全書結構嚴謹,理論講解與大量真實可操作的範例緊密結閤,確保學習者能夠從零基礎快速邁嚮獨立開發高效率、響應式動態網站的能力。 第一部分:Web開發基礎與PHP 7.x核心技術 本部分內容建立堅實的編程基礎,為後續復雜應用開發打下根基。 1. Web工作原理與環境搭建 詳細介紹客戶端(瀏覽器)與服務器(Web服務器如Apache/Nginx)之間的交互機製,包括HTTP協議的基本概念、請求與響應的生命周期。重點指導讀者如何在本地搭建完整的PHP開發環境,涵蓋XAMPP/WAMP/LNMP等主流集成包的安裝、配置與故障排查,確保學習環境的穩定高效。 2. PHP 7.x 語法精講與特性引入 深入剖析PHP 7.x引入的關鍵性能優化和語法改進。內容涵蓋變量、數據類型(包括標量、復閤、資源、特殊類型)、運算符、流程控製結構(順序、選擇、循環)。特彆強調類型聲明(標量類型、返迴類型)、null閤並運算符(?)、匿名類等現代PHP特性,指導開發者編寫更健壯、更易讀的代碼。 3. 函數、數組與麵嚮對象編程(OOP) 係統講解內置函數的使用,並指導用戶自定義函數,探討函數的遞歸調用與作用域問題。數組部分深入剖析索引數組和關聯數組的操作、遍曆與多維數組處理。 麵嚮對象編程是本書的核心理論支柱之一。詳細講解類(Class)、對象(Object)、封裝、繼承與多態三大特性。深入探討抽象類、接口(Interface)、抽象方法、魔術方法(Magic Methods)的應用,以及PHP 7.x中對Trait的優化使用,幫助讀者理解並實踐高內聚、低耦閤的編程思想。 4. 文件操作、會話管理與安全基礎 講解如何使用PHP進行服務器端的文件讀寫、目錄操作以及文件上傳處理。詳述Session(會話)和Cookie的工作機製,實現用戶登錄狀態的維持和個性化設置。同時,引入Web安全基礎知識,如防止XSS(跨站腳本攻擊)和CSRF(跨站請求僞造)的基本防禦措施。 第二部分:MySQL數據庫設計與PHP交互 本部分專注於數據的持久化存儲與高效管理,這是所有動態網站的靈魂所在。 1. 關係型數據庫基礎與MySQL 8.0特性 概述關係型數據庫(RDBMS)的基本概念,如實體、關係、主鍵、外鍵等。重點介紹MySQL 8.0的新特性,包括更強大的JSON支持、窗口函數、公用錶錶達式(CTE)等。 2. SQL語言精通 從基礎的數據查詢語言(DQL)開始,全麵講解`SELECT`語句的各種復雜用法,包括多錶連接(`INNER JOIN`, `LEFT JOIN`, `RIGHT JOIN`)、子查詢、分組(`GROUP BY`)與過濾(`HAVING`)。進階內容覆蓋數據定義語言(DDL)(創建、修改、刪除錶結構)和數據操作語言(DML)(插入、更新、刪除數據)。 3. PHP與MySQL的連接與操作(PDO/mysqli) 本書推薦並詳細教授使用PHP Data Objects (PDO)進行數據庫交互,因為它提供瞭跨數據庫係統的兼容性和更強的安全性。詳細演示如何建立數據庫連接、執行SQL語句,並重點講解如何利用預處理語句(Prepared Statements)來有效防禦SQL注入攻擊,這是現代Web應用開發中不可或缺的安全實踐。 4. 數據庫設計範式與實戰建模 指導讀者如何遵循數據庫設計範式(1NF, 2NF, 3NF)來設計高效、無冗餘的數據庫結構。通過一個完整的案例(如電商係統或博客係統),演示從需求分析到最終錶結構實現的完整建模過程。 第三部分:AJAX驅動的無刷新交互技術 本部分將內容提升到前端與後端無縫協作的層麵,實現現代用戶體驗。 1. JavaScript與DOM基礎迴顧 快速迴顧必需的JavaScript核心知識點,特彆是DOM(文檔對象模型)的結構與操作方法,為理解AJAX打下基礎。 2. AJAX核心原理與XMLHttpRequest對象 係統闡述AJAX(Asynchronous JavaScript and XML)的本質——異步數據交互。深入解析`XMLHttpRequest`對象的創建、配置、事件監聽(`readyState`, `status`)以及如何發送GET和POST請求。 3. 使用Fetch API替代傳統AJAX 介紹當前更現代、基於Promise的Fetch API,展示如何使用它來簡化異步請求的編寫,處理請求頭、請求體(JSON/FormData)以及異常捕獲。 4. PHP後端API的構建與JSON數據傳輸 演示如何構建專門用於響應AJAX請求的PHP腳本接口。核心內容是如何使用PHP的內置函數(如`json_encode`和`json_decode`)來規範化地封裝和解析JSON數據格式,這是前後端數據交換的標準。 5. 綜閤實戰項目:動態內容加載與錶單驗證 通過兩個關鍵範例鞏固AJAX知識: 動態內容加載: 實現一個分頁或無限滾動的列錶,數據通過AJAX從服務器獲取並插入到頁麵中,無需刷新整個頁麵。 前端/後端同步驗證: 實現用戶注冊或登錄時,使用AJAX實時檢查用戶名是否已被占用,並嚮用戶即時反饋結果。 第四部分:項目實戰與部署優化 本部分將前麵所學的零散技術整閤為一個完整的、具備生産潛力的Web應用,並討論上綫部署的注意事項。 1. 推薦的MVC架構思想(輕量級) 在實戰項目中引入輕量級的Model-View-Controller(MVC)設計模式思想,指導開發者如何分離數據處理(Model)、界麵展示(View)和業務邏輯(Controller),提高代碼的可維護性。 2. 完整的Web應用構建 以一個中等復雜度的係統(例如:一個留言闆係統或一個簡單的庫存管理係統)為例,貫穿需求分析、數據庫設計、後端業務邏輯編寫、安全加固以及AJAX驅動的動態交互實現全過程。 3. 性能優化與部署 介紹PHP代碼層麵的性能優化技巧(如閤理使用緩存、避免N+1查詢問題)。最後,指導讀者如何將開發完成的項目安全、穩定地部署到虛擬主機或雲服務器上,涵蓋FTP上傳、數據庫遷移以及Web服務器配置的關鍵點。 全書範例代碼豐富,注重代碼的規範性和可讀性,力求讓讀者在完成每一個章節的學習後,都能掌握一項可立即應用於實際工作中的技能。

著者信息

圖書目錄

圖書序言

圖書試讀

用戶評價

评分

作為一名 PHP 開發的老玩傢,看到這本《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》的齣現,我還是相當期待的。雖然我已經接觸 PHP 多年,但技術更新迭代的速度總是讓人應接不暇,尤其是在 PHP 7 之後,性能和新特性的引入,確實帶來瞭不少驚喜。我一直認為,掌握最新的技術理念,並將其有效地應用到實際的項目中,是保持競爭力的關鍵。這本書的書名就點明瞭核心,PHP 7 的高性能,MySQL 的強大數據庫支持,以及 AJAX 帶來的交互式用戶體驗,這三者的結閤,恰恰是現代網頁設計中最核心的部分。我希望通過這本書,能夠更深入地理解 PHP 7 的新特性,比如類型聲明、返迴值類型、空閤並運算符等等,以及它們如何在實際開發中提升代碼的健壯性和可讀性。同時,對於 MySQL 的優化和更高級的查詢技巧,以及如何在 AJAX 中更靈活地處理數據,我也抱有濃厚的興趣。畢竟,理論知識固然重要,但最終還是要落腳到實際的項目構建和應用。這本書的“範例教本”定位,也讓我對它寄予厚望,我希望書中能有足夠多、足夠貼近實際應用場景的例子,能夠讓我邊學邊練,快速將知識轉化為技能。

评分

最近在學習網頁開發,對 PHP 這個語言一直有些好奇,身邊很多朋友都在用,而且都說 PHP 配閤 MySQL 和 AJAX 能夠做齣很酷的網頁。所以,當我在書店看到《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》時,就覺得這是我入門的一個絕佳機會。這本書的厚度看起來很紮實,封麵設計也比較現代,感覺內容應該不會太陳舊。我特彆關注 AJAX 的部分,因為我見過很多網站,點擊按鈕頁麵卻不需要刷新就能顯示新的內容,這種流暢的用戶體驗是我非常想實現的。我希望能在這本書裏找到關於 AJAX 的詳細解釋,比如它是如何工作的,有哪些常用的框架或庫,以及如何用它來與服務器進行異步通信。此外,PHP 7 的新特性我也想瞭解一下,畢竟老版本可能已經不太主流瞭。MySQL 作為數據庫,雖然我對它瞭解不多,但知道它是處理數據必不可少的工具,希望這本書也能給我一個清晰的入門介紹,教會我如何設計數據庫、編寫 SQL 語句,以及如何將 PHP 與 MySQL 連接起來進行數據的增刪改查。總之,我希望這本書能夠一步一步地引導我,從零基礎到能夠獨立完成一個簡單的動態網頁項目。

评分

我對 Web 開發的興趣由來已久,尤其關注那些能夠帶來流暢用戶體驗的技術。《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》這個書名,恰好概括瞭我一直想深入瞭解的幾個重要方麵。PHP 7 相較於之前的版本,在性能和一些新特性上的改進是顯而易見的,我非常希望這本書能詳細闡述這些新特性,比如它在提高網站響應速度和優化內存使用方麵的優勢,以及如何將這些優勢體現在具體的代碼實現中。MySQL 作為後端數據庫,在數據存儲和管理方麵的重要性不言而喻,我期待這本書能提供關於數據庫設計的最佳實踐,以及如何編寫高效、安全的 SQL 查詢語句,以應對日益增長的數據量和復雜的業務邏輯。而 AJAX,我一直認為它是提升用戶體驗的關鍵技術,能夠讓網頁在不刷新頁麵的情況下實現數據的動態加載和交互,我希望這本書能夠深入講解 AJAX 的工作原理,並提供豐富的實戰案例,教我如何使用它來構建更具響應性和吸引力的 Web 應用。這本書的“範例教本”定位,更是讓我相信它能夠通過大量的實例,將理論知識轉化為實際的開發技能,讓我能夠快速上手,構建齣符閤現代 Web 標準的優秀網頁。

评分

作為一名對網頁設計充滿熱情但又稍顯新手的小白,我一直在尋找一本能夠係統性地教會我構建現代網頁的書籍。《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》的名字讓我眼前一亮,它涵蓋瞭我一直想學的關鍵技術:PHP、MySQL 和 AJAX。從書名來看,它似乎能夠提供一個完整的解決方案,讓我從基礎開始,逐步掌握如何利用這些技術來創建功能豐富、用戶體驗良好的網頁。我特彆希望這本書能夠用最易懂的方式解釋 PHP 的基本概念,比如變量、循環、函數等,並教我如何編寫能夠與服務器進行交互的 PHP 腳本。對於 MySQL,我希望能夠學習如何創建和管理數據庫,以及如何使用 SQL 語句來獲取和處理數據。最讓我興奮的是 AJAX,我一直對那些無需刷新就能動態更新內容的網頁很著迷,希望這本書能教會我如何實現這種效果,讓我的網頁變得更加生動和交互。這本書的“範例教本”形式,讓我相信它會提供大量的實踐機會,能夠幫助我鞏固所學的知識,並快速上手實際的開發工作。

评分

我是一名有著幾年 PHP 開發經驗的開發者,主要的工作項目涉及到一些傳統的 PHP 框架。但是,隨著前端技術和後端框架的飛速發展,我感覺自己需要一次“充電”。《新觀念 PHP7+MySQL+AJAX 網頁設計範例教本 第五版》這個名字聽起來就非常有吸引力,它精準地抓住瞭當下 Web 開發的核心技術棧。我特彆看重“新觀念”這個詞,這暗示著這本書不會僅僅停留在基礎語法的講解,更會側重於現代化的開發模式和最佳實踐。PHP 7 的性能提升和新特性,例如更優化的執行效率、更強的類型約束能力,以及一些便利的新語法,都是我非常想深入研究的。我希望這本書能夠詳細地講解如何在實際項目中應用這些新特性,如何寫齣更具可維護性和可擴展性的 PHP 代碼。同時,對於 AJAX 的部分,我也期待它能介紹一些最新的 AJAX 異步請求處理方式,以及如何與 PHP 7 結閤,構建響應更快的動態交互界麵。此外,MySQL 的部分,我希望能看到關於數據庫設計、性能優化以及安全方麵的深入探討,而不僅僅是基礎的 CRUD 操作。這本書的“範例教本”形式,也讓我對它的實用性充滿信心。

相關圖書

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2025 ttbooks.qciss.net All Rights Reserved. 小特书站 版權所有